Team Supreme shows promising future

Track Club picks up two bronze medals at TTAF State Games in Corpus Christi

Corsicana — The Team Supreme Track Club offered up more evidence this weekend that the future of Corsicana track is very promising.

Team Supreme picked up two bronze medals in relays at the TTAF State Games of Texas track and field meet in Corpus Christi.

They won with an older team, and a young one too.

The girls 18 and under team of Makenzie Lee, Megan Moultrie, Robin Henley and Michelle Turner took third place in the mile relay. They ran a time of 45.58. They finished behind Wings Track Club (4:05.50) and Whitehouse/Tyler Metro (4:08.74).

The boys 14 and under team of Jerry Hall, Ryan Brown, Kishawn Kelley and Jamichea Polk also picked up a bronze medal in the 400 meter relay. They ran a time of 45.58. They finished behind Sprinters (44.49) and Garland (44.55).

Polk also took fourth place in the 14 and under 100 meter dash. Polk ran a time of 11.74. Waco’s Quintin Dancer was first with a time of 11.25
